OEE is a “best prac,ces” way to monitor and improve the effec,veness of your manufacturing processes (i.e. machines, manufacturing cells, assembly lines)
OEE is a standard measure of performance which brings together the three most significant produc,on metrics – Availability, Performance and Quality

OEE is simple and prac,cal. It takes the most common and important sources of manufacturing produc,vity loss, places them into three primary categories and dis,lls them into metrics that provide an excellent gauge for measuring where you are – and how you can improve!

OEE is frequently used as a key metric in TPM (Total Produc,ve Maintenance) and Lean Manufacturing programs and gives you a consistent way to measure the effec,veness of TPM and other ini,a,ves by providing an overall framework for measuring produc,on efficiency.

Direct Part MarkingDirect part marking is used to track individual pieces or components. A glyph is a special mark placed on each part. It contains an ultra-‐secure encrypted serial number, sustains extreme field condi,ons, can be read on curved surfaces, and is s,ll readable even if 80% of the image is destroyed. Direct Part Marking provides extremely detailed level of traceability

Putting it all together… THE GOAL
OEE Factor World Class Availability 90.0% Performance 95.0% Quality 99.9% OEE 85.0%
